Transaction 568b712d0e93474a5a2a27cd822089b6bd71ec9a243cf3c195d74d2839fb209e
1 Input
2 Outputs
- 568b712d0e93474a5a2a27cd822089b6bd71ec9a243cf3c195d74d2839fb209e:0
- 568b712d0e93474a5a2a27cd822089b6bd71ec9a243cf3c195d74d2839fb209e:1
value 16420103
address 1K7ttSW7LwcW1aZKsdNy6boG5S6rLDs2LB
value 878351
address 1D7tBFGsqFxFuNLjmL86NV8ep8vcjWRvGe